diff --git a/docker/pom.xml b/docker/pom.xml
deleted file mode 100644
index 29da5f9..0000000
--- a/docker/pom.xml
+++ /dev/null
@@ -1,93 +0,0 @@
-
-
-
- 4.0.0
-
- com.manorrock.aegean
- project
- 24.8.0-SNAPSHOT
-
- aegean-docker
- pom
- Manorrock Aegean - Docker
-
-
- docker
-
-
- com.manorrock.aegean
- aegean
- ${project.version}
- provided
- war
-
-
-
-
-
- org.apache.maven.plugins
- maven-dependency-plugin
- 3.7.1
-
-
- copy
- package
-
- copy
-
-
-
-
-
-
- com.manorrock.aegean
- aegean
- ${project.version}
- war
- true
- ${project.build.directory}/wars
- aegean.war
-
-
- ${project.build.directory}/wars
- true
- true
-
-
-
- io.fabric8
- docker-maven-plugin
- 0.44.0
-
-
-
- persian
- ghcr.io/manorrock/aegean:%l
-
-
-
- linux/amd64
- linux/arm64
-
-
- ${basedir}
- src/main/docker/Dockerfile
-
-
-
-
-
-
- build
- install
-
- build
-
-
-
-
-
-
-
-
-
diff --git a/docker/src/main/docker/Dockerfile b/docker/src/main/docker/Dockerfile
deleted file mode 100644
index ab4f920..0000000
--- a/docker/src/main/docker/Dockerfile
+++ /dev/null
@@ -1,16 +0,0 @@
-FROM eclipse-temurin:21
-RUN cd /opt && \
- export TOMCAT_VERSION=9.0.90 && \
- curl --insecure -L -O https://archive.apache.org/dist/tomcat/tomcat-9/v${TOMCAT_VERSION}/bin/apache-tomcat-${TOMCAT_VERSION}.tar.gz && \
- tar xfvz apache-tomcat-${TOMCAT_VERSION}.tar.gz && \
- mv apache-tomcat-${TOMCAT_VERSION} tomcat && \
- rm apache-tomcat-${TOMCAT_VERSION}.tar.gz && \
- rm -rf tomcat/webapps/*docs* && \
- rm -rf tomcat/webapps/*examples* && \
- rm -rf tomcat/webapps/*manager* && \
- rm -rf tomcat/webapps/ROOT*
-CMD ["/opt/tomcat/bin/catalina.sh", "run"]
-EXPOSE 8080
-WORKDIR /mnt
-ENV ROOT_DIRECTORY /mnt
-COPY target/wars/aegean.war /opt/tomcat/webapps/ROOT.war
diff --git a/pom.xml b/pom.xml
index 77421a3..e4989c2 100644
--- a/pom.xml
+++ b/pom.xml
@@ -4,21 +4,115 @@
4.0.0
com.manorrock.aegean
project
- 24.8.0-SNAPSHOT
- pom
- Manorrock Aegean - Project
+ 25.2.0-SNAPSHOT
+ war
+ Manorrock Aegean
Manorrock.com
http://www.manorrock.com
+
+ 2.0.2
+ 6.10.0.202406032230-r
+ 3.1.9.Final
+ 4.0.4
+
+ 0.45.1
+ 3.13.0
3.2.4
+ 3.4.0
+
+ 21
+ UTF-8
-
- docker
- repo
-
+
+
+ org.eclipse.jgit
+ org.eclipse.jgit.http.server
+ ${jgit.version}
+ compile
+
+
+ jakarta.servlet
+ jakarta.servlet-api
+ ${servlet.version}
+ provided
+
+
+ jakarta.enterprise
+ jakarta.enterprise.cdi-api
+ ${cdi.version}
+ provided
+
+
+ org.jboss.weld.servlet
+ weld-servlet-shaded
+ ${weld.version}
+ runtime
+
+
+
+ aegean
+
+
+ org.apache.maven.plugins
+ maven-compiler-plugin
+ ${maven-compiler-plugin.version}
+
+ ${java.version}
+
+
+
+ org.apache.maven.plugins
+ maven-war-plugin
+ ${maven-war-plugin.version}
+
+ false
+
+
+
+
+
+ docker
+
+
+
+ io.fabric8
+ docker-maven-plugin
+ ${docker-maven-plugin.version}
+
+
+
+ persian
+ ghcr.io/manorrock/aegean:%l
+
+
+
+ linux/amd64
+ linux/arm64
+
+
+ ${basedir}
+ src/main/docker/Dockerfile
+
+
+
+
+
+
+ build
+ install
+
+ build
+
+
+
+
+
+
+
- 2.0.2
- 6.10.0.202406032230-r
- 2.3.21
- 3.1.9.Final
- 4.0.4
-
- 0.42.1
- 3.13.0
- 3.4.0
-
- 21
- UTF-8
-
-
- aegean
-
-
- org.apache.maven.plugins
- maven-compiler-plugin
- ${maven-compiler-plugin.version}
-
- ${java.version}
-
-
-
- org.apache.maven.plugins
- maven-war-plugin
- ${maven-war-plugin.version}
-
- false
-
-
-
-
-
-
- org.eclipse.jgit
- org.eclipse.jgit.http.server
- ${jgit.version}
- compile
-
-
- jakarta.servlet
- jakarta.servlet-api
- ${servlet.version}
- provided
-
-
- jakarta.enterprise
- jakarta.enterprise.cdi-api
- ${cdi.version}
- provided
-
-
- org.jboss.weld.servlet
- weld-servlet-shaded
- ${weld.version}
- runtime
-
-
- org.glassfish
- jakarta.faces
- ${mojarra.version}
-
-
-
-
- docker
-
-
-
- io.fabric8
- docker-maven-plugin
- ${docker-maven-plugin.version}
-
-
-
- aegean
- ghcr.io/manorrock/aegean:%l
-
-
-
- linux/amd64
- linux/arm64/v8
-
-
- ${basedir}
- src/main/docker/Dockerfile
-
-
-
-
-
-
- build
- install
-
- build
-
-
-
- push
- deploy
-
- push
-
-
-
-
-
-
-
-
-
diff --git a/repo/src/main/docker/Dockerfile b/src/main/docker/Dockerfile
similarity index 100%
rename from repo/src/main/docker/Dockerfile
rename to src/main/docker/Dockerfile
diff --git a/repo/src/main/java/com/manorrock/aegean/Application.java b/src/main/java/com/manorrock/aegean/GitApplication.java
similarity index 96%
rename from repo/src/main/java/com/manorrock/aegean/Application.java
rename to src/main/java/com/manorrock/aegean/GitApplication.java
index d1a83bc..c780ae6 100644
--- a/repo/src/main/java/com/manorrock/aegean/Application.java
+++ b/src/main/java/com/manorrock/aegean/GitApplication.java
@@ -37,12 +37,12 @@
* @author Manfred Riem (mriem@manorrock.com)
*/
@ApplicationScoped
-public class Application {
+public class GitApplication {
/**
* Stores the logger.
*/
- private static final Logger LOGGER = Logger.getLogger(Application.class.getName());
+ private static final Logger LOGGER = Logger.getLogger(GitApplication.class.getName());
/**
* Stores the repositories directory.
diff --git a/repo/src/main/java/com/manorrock/aegean/GitHttpServlet.java b/src/main/java/com/manorrock/aegean/GitHttpServlet.java
similarity index 99%
rename from repo/src/main/java/com/manorrock/aegean/GitHttpServlet.java
rename to src/main/java/com/manorrock/aegean/GitHttpServlet.java
index 158b850..2398883 100644
--- a/repo/src/main/java/com/manorrock/aegean/GitHttpServlet.java
+++ b/src/main/java/com/manorrock/aegean/GitHttpServlet.java
@@ -56,7 +56,7 @@ public class GitHttpServlet extends HttpServlet {
* Stores the application.
*/
@Inject
- private Application application;
+ private GitApplication application;
/**
* Stores the Git filter.
diff --git a/repo/src/main/java/com/manorrock/aegean/GitRepositoryResolver.java b/src/main/java/com/manorrock/aegean/GitRepositoryResolver.java
similarity index 100%
rename from repo/src/main/java/com/manorrock/aegean/GitRepositoryResolver.java
rename to src/main/java/com/manorrock/aegean/GitRepositoryResolver.java
diff --git a/repo/src/main/webapp/META-INF/context.xml b/src/main/webapp/META-INF/context.xml
similarity index 100%
rename from repo/src/main/webapp/META-INF/context.xml
rename to src/main/webapp/META-INF/context.xml
diff --git a/repo/src/main/webapp/WEB-INF/beans.xml b/src/main/webapp/WEB-INF/beans.xml
similarity index 100%
rename from repo/src/main/webapp/WEB-INF/beans.xml
rename to src/main/webapp/WEB-INF/beans.xml
diff --git a/repo/src/main/webapp/WEB-INF/web.xml b/src/main/webapp/WEB-INF/web.xml
similarity index 100%
rename from repo/src/main/webapp/WEB-INF/web.xml
rename to src/main/webapp/WEB-INF/web.xml